The Texas State Bobcats (1-6) will welcome the New Mexico State Aggies (2-6) to San Marcos, Texas on Saturday, October 27th, 2018. Kick-off is set for 7:00 PM ET and will be available on ESPN+ for live streaming. These two teams have met annually since 2014. Presently, the Aggies of New Mexico State own a three-game winning streak against the Bobcats both straight up and against the spread. Last year in Las Cruces, New Mexico State defeated Texas State 45-35.
New Mexico State Aggies at Texas State Bobcats Overview
New Mexico State Aggies
The Aggies come into this contest on the heels of a two-game losing streak. Most recently, the Aggies hosted the up-start Georgia Southern Eagles in Las Cruces and were defeated 48-31, failing to cover as a 9.5-point home dog. Though New Mexico State has hit some rough patches, there are still some positives. The offense is now firing on all cylinders as it has broken the 30-point threshold in its last three outings.
Texas State Bobcats
The Bobcats enter into this affair riding a five-game losing streak. On the year, Texas State does not own a win against an FBS opponent. T-State’s only victory was earned against Texas Southern in September where it failed to cover a lofty 33-point line winning by just 16.
